Biography

Winifred was born July 12, 1904 in Wigan, Lancashire, England and was baptised there on August 21st at St Andrew's. She is the daughter of Elizabeth Freestone and John Frederick Bone. Her father's occupation was coach builder and they were living at 41 Ryland Street. On her Birth Registration Record her mother's maiden name was listed as Freestone[1]

1911 CENSUS - Brickkiln Lane, Shepshed, Leicestershire, England [2][3]

Elizabeth Brown 42 Wife Enderby, Leicestershire
Evelyn Nellie Brown 19 Dau (born BROWN) Enderby, Leicestershire
Elsie Brown 18 Dau (born BROWN) Shepshed, Leicestershire
George Brown 12 Son (born BONE) Wigan, Lancashire
Edith Brown 10 Dau (born BONE) Wigan, Lancashire
Fred Brown 9 Son (born BONE) Wigan, Lancashire
Winifred Mary Brown 6 Dau (born BONE) Wigan, Lancashire
Dora Brown 2 Dau (born BROWN) Shepshed, Leicestershire

She married Henry Richard Fullman in 1933 in Coventry, Warwickshire, England, the same city as her sister Dora's marriage in 1935 and they were the parents of at least 1 child.[4]

Winifred died in 1991 in Coventry, Warwickshire and on her death record, her date of birth was given as July 12, 1904.[5]
